XC6124F717ER-G Description
The XC6124F717ER-G is a high-performance watchdog circuit designed by Torex Semiconductor Ltd., a leading manufacturer in the power management integrated circuit (PMIC) domain. This IC supervisor is specifically engineered to monitor a single voltage channel with a threshold of 1.7V. It features a typical reset timeout of 800ms, ensuring reliable system resets under various operating conditions. The device is packaged in a surface-mount format, specifically a 6USPC (6-Lead Ultra Small Plastic Chip) package, making it ideal for compact and space-constrained applications. The XC6124F717ER-G is available in tape and reel (TR) packaging, facilitating efficient manufacturing processes.
XC6124F717ER-G Features
- Single Voltage Monitoring: The XC6124F717ER-G is designed to monitor a single voltage channel, providing precise control and monitoring for critical power supply lines.
- 1.7V Threshold: The device features a voltage threshold of 1.7V, making it suitable for applications requiring low-voltage monitoring.
- 800ms Typical Reset Timeout: The reset timeout is set at 800ms, ensuring that the system has sufficient time to stabilize before a reset is triggered.
- Open Drain or Open Collector Output: The output configuration of the XC6124F717ER-G is versatile, supporting both open drain and open collector setups, which enhances its compatibility with various system architectures.
- Active Low Reset: The reset function is active low, which is a common requirement in many digital systems, ensuring compatibility and ease of integration.
- Surface Mount Technology (SMT): The surface-mount mounting type allows for efficient and reliable integration into modern PCB designs, reducing the overall footprint and enhancing thermal performance.
-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L) 1: The XC6124F717ER-G has an MSL rating of 1, indicating that it is not sensitive to moisture, which is beneficial for applications in humid or varying environmental conditions.
- Compliance and Standards: The device is REACH unaffected and RoHS3 compliant, ensuring it meets the stringent environmental and safety standards required by the electronics industry.
